Job description

Overview

Fuse Energy is a forward-thinking renewable energy company on a mission to deliver a terawatt of clean energy globally. We are creating a fully integrated energy system: from developing utility-scale solar and wind projects to real-time power trading and distributed energy installations. By selling directly to consumers, we lower costs and pass the savings on to our customers.

We're building a new Training Centre in Birmingham to bring engineer training and assessment in-house. We're looking for a Centre Manager to lead it; running the centre day to day, owning its quality and accreditation, and building Birmingham into a fully accredited training operation. This is a leadership and quality-assurance role rather than a hands-on training role: you'll manage the trainers, and you'll be the person who makes sure the centre meets its standards.

Responsibilities
  • Run the day-to-day operation of the training centre - facilities, scheduling, budget, and team.
  • Lead and line-manage the training team.
  • Own the centre's quality-management system and lead internal quality assurance - independently sampling and verifying trainers' assessment decisions.
  • Own the centre's accreditation: act as the named point of contact for the awarding bodies, and take the centre through approval and ongoing audits.
  • Build and maintain the centre's compliance framework - health & safety, safeguarding, data protection, equality & diversity, malpractice and appeals.
  • Lead health & safety across a site with live gas and electrical practical work.
  • Drive continuous improvement across the centre's training and quality operations.
  • Level 4 Internal Quality Assurance qualification (IQA/V1, or equivalent), so you can verify assessment decisions across the centre.
  • Level 3 Award in Education and Training (AET).
  • A recognised assessing qualification (TAQA, CAVA, or equivalent).
  • Experience managing a training centre, workshop, or similar technical/vocational operation, including managing people and owning a budget. li>
  • Hands-on technical background in at least one of our training areas - smart metering (gas and electric), electrical, EV installation, heat pumps, solar, BESS. li>
  • Experience owning compliance and quality standards for a training or technical operation - ideally as a point of contact for an awarding body or accreditation scheme. li>
  • Health & safety leadership experience across technical or practical work. li>
Nice-to-haves
  • IOSH/NEBOSH or equivalent health & safety management qualification. li>
  • Experience working as an electrician / JIB Gold Card. li>
  • Experience taking a training centre through awarding-body approval. li>
